libtasks Documentation
1.6
Main Page
Namespaces
Classes
Files
Class List
Class Hierarchy
Class Members
tasks::net::uwsgi_task Member List
This is the complete list of members for
tasks::net::uwsgi_task
, including all inherited members.
add_task
(net_io_task *task)
tasks::net_io_task
static
add_task
(worker *worker, net_io_task *task)
tasks::net_io_task
protected
assign_worker
(worker *worker)
tasks::event_task
assigned_worker
() const
tasks::event_task
inline
auto_delete
() const
tasks::task
inline
can_dispose
() const
tasks::disposable
inline
disable_auto_close
()
tasks::net_io_task
inline
protected
disable_auto_delete
()
tasks::task
inline
disable_dispose
()
tasks::disposable
inline
disposable
()
tasks::disposable
inline
dispose
(worker *worker)
tasks::io_task_base
virtual
enable_dispose
()
tasks::disposable
inline
error
() const
tasks::error_base
inline
error_base
()
tasks::error_base
inline
error_code
() const
tasks::error_base
inline
error_func_void_t
typedef
tasks::event_task
error_func_worker_t
typedef
tasks::event_task
error_message
() const
tasks::error_base
inline
events
() const
tasks::io_task_base
inline
exception
() const
tasks::error_base
inline
finish
(worker *worker=nullptr)
tasks::task
finish_func_void_t
typedef
tasks::task
finish_func_worker_t
typedef
tasks::task
finish_request
()
tasks::net::uwsgi_task
inline
protected
get_string
() const
tasks::net_io_task
inline
handle_event
(tasks::worker *worker, int revents)
tasks::net::uwsgi_task
virtual
handle_request
()=0
tasks::net::uwsgi_task
pure virtual
init_watcher
()
tasks::io_task_base
virtual
io_task_base
(int events)
tasks::io_task_base
iob
()
tasks::net_io_task
inline
protected
virtual
iob
() const
tasks::net_io_task
inline
protected
virtual
m_request
tasks::net::uwsgi_task
protected
m_response
tasks::net::uwsgi_task
protected
net_io_task
(int events)
tasks::net_io_task
inline
net_io_task
(net::socket &socket, int events)
tasks::net_io_task
notify_error
(worker *worker=nullptr)
tasks::event_task
on_error
(error_func_worker_t f)
tasks::event_task
inline
on_error
(error_func_void_t f)
tasks::event_task
inline
on_finish
(finish_func_worker_t f)
tasks::task
inline
on_finish
(finish_func_void_t f)
tasks::task
inline
request
()
tasks::net::uwsgi_task
inline
request
() const
tasks::net::uwsgi_task
inline
request_p
()
tasks::net::uwsgi_task
inline
request_p
() const
tasks::net::uwsgi_task
inline
reset_error
()
tasks::error_base
inline
response
()
tasks::net::uwsgi_task
inline
response
() const
tasks::net::uwsgi_task
inline
response_p
()
tasks::net::uwsgi_task
inline
response_p
() const
tasks::net::uwsgi_task
inline
send_response
()
tasks::net::uwsgi_task
inline
set_events
(int events)
tasks::io_task_base
protected
set_exception
(tasks_exception &e)
tasks::error_base
inline
socket
()
tasks::net_io_task
inline
socket
() const
tasks::net_io_task
inline
start_watcher
(worker *worker)
tasks::io_task_base
virtual
stop_watcher
(worker *worker)
tasks::io_task_base
virtual
sys_errno
() const
tasks::error_base
inline
sys_errno_str
() const
tasks::error_base
inline
update_watcher
(worker *worker)
tasks::io_task_base
virtual
uwsgi_task
(net::socket &sock)
tasks::net::uwsgi_task
inline
watcher
() const
tasks::io_task_base
inline
~disposable
()
tasks::disposable
inline
virtual
~error_base
()
tasks::error_base
inline
virtual
~event_task
()
tasks::event_task
inline
virtual
~io_task_base
()
tasks::io_task_base
inline
virtual
~net_io_task
()
tasks::net_io_task
virtual
~task
()
tasks::task
inline
virtual
~uwsgi_task
()
tasks::net::uwsgi_task
inline
virtual
Generated by
1.8.6